    Take a look at Jennifer King's Wiki and you'll see a resume / exposure to the sport that basically mimics what you'd see from a male football player a couple of years removed from the game looking to transition into coaching. Actually her resume is even more robust in a lot of ways. She played two offensive and two defensive positions in a 13 year career, has experience coaching at the college level, and even had the time to be an intern with the Carolina Panthers while still being an active player in the women's league.

    She's involved in running backs but never played the position. That's not uncommon, didn't Major coach running backs at one point?
